Output 254358921bc13cd17f27640e94a0f2e5fa0449edbb72f6ef4b0b9c07d8ae9460:57

value
71048826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 790c5e186a21d67335ff60d0afd1b621e9c39ea4 OP_EQUAL
address
MJwCoxLDZCfq5LMcokXeDY6cw4USyzKzAQ
transaction
254358921bc13cd17f27640e94a0f2e5fa0449edbb72f6ef4b0b9c07d8ae9460
spent
true